There exists a social and cultural disconnection between journalists and
their readers, which helps explain why the "standard templates" of the news
room seem alien for many readers. In a recent survey, questionnaires were (1)______
sent to reporters in five middle-sized cities around the country, plus one
large metropolitan area. Then residents in these communities were phoned
on random and asked the same questions. (2)______
Replies show that compared with other Americans, journalists are more
likely to live in upscale neighborhoods, have maids, own Mercedeses, and
trade stocks, and they’re less likely to go to church, do volunteer work, or
put roots in a community. (3)______
Reporters tend to be part of broadly defined social and cultural elite, so (4)______
their work tends to reflect conventional values. The astonishing distrust of
the news media isn’t rooted in inaccurate or poor reportorial skills but in the (5)______
daily clash of world views between reporters and their readers.
This is an explosive situation for any industry, particularly a declining
one. Here is a troubling business that keeps hiring employees whose at- (6)______
titudes vastly annoy the customers. Then it sponsors lots of symposiums
and a credibility project dedicated to wonder why customers are annoyed (7)______
and fleeing in large numbers. But it never seems to get around to notice the (8)______
cultural and class biases that so many former buyers are complaining about.
If it does, it would open up its diversity program, now focusing broadly on (9)______
race and gender, and look for reporters who differ broadly by outlook, val- (10)_____
ues, education and class. [br] (9)
